Auto locksmiths that specialize in keys for cars have a wide variety of tools to handle various situations. https://www.g28carkeys.co.uk/ can use these tools to cut keys, program smart keys, or even repair the ignition if it has been damaged. They also have a range of lockout tools that permit them to gain entry into vehicles without damaging the lock. They then can get their customers back in the car quickly and efficiently.

The most crucial tools needed by an auto locksmith include an automotive lockout kit, a set of slim jims, and an electronic device to clone. The tool for unlocking the car is used to create a gap within the door frame. This is then used to push the lock in. The kit also comes with an oil that makes picking the lock simpler. A slim jim or spring steel with the right shapes cut into it, is used to grasp the locking mechanisms in a car.

A computer cloning device can duplicate a transponder key, which can be then programmed to a specific vehicle. This is especially helpful when keys have been lost or stolen. These devices can run up to $3,000 however they're extremely durable and easy to use. They can be found in a variety of hardware stores and online.

Contrary to locks of the past which have a code on keys, modern car keys are encrypted with computer chips. It is essential to program them so that they work with a specific vehicle. This requires specialized equipment and software. To accomplish this, the locksmith must first obtain the appropriate programming protocol for that particular car model. These tools are produced by various companies that include Advanced Diagnostics. They market their products under a variety names, including T-Code Pro and Codeseeker.

The technician should test the key after it has been programmed to confirm that it is working. If it isn't, they will have to do it again. This can be a long and costly process, which is why it's important for an automotive locksmith to have the proper tools for this job.

Rates

The rate charged by locksmiths for car keys varies greatly based on the type of service. The basic services, such as unlocking a car cost between $50-$100, however other services can be quite expensive. Changing the locks on a car door, for example, can cost up to $100. Locksmiths typically charge by the hour which means that longer jobs will raise the total cost of the job.

Understanding how locksmiths determine their rates is important for choosing a trustworthy and affordable one. Some scammers take advantage of people who are in need by charging too much or employing bait and switch tactics. Ask for a quote on the phone, and make sure the locksmith is licensed and licensed. Also, they must be bonded.

Another thing to take into consideration is the time of day. Emergency services are often more expensive, particularly when they are needed outside of normal business times.
